Sentar is seeking an Endpoint Security Operator (CrowdStrike) in Charleston!
This Integrated Product Team (IPT) is charged with the mission of conducting Defensive Cyberspace Operations to defend subscriber networks. The DHA Cybersecurity Operations Center (CyOC) coordinates and orchestrates cybersecurity activities execution at the DoD Component scale to protect information systems against unauthorized activity, vulnerabilities, or threats.
The Endpoint Security Operator is responsible for the technical administration, operational response, and management of the enterprise's end point security platform and supplemental endpoint security solutions as needed. The role ensures the health of the sensors across all endpoints, manages security policies to meet compliance directives, and serves as a subject matter expert on endpoint threat mitigation. This position performs hands-on triage of security events, validates security configurations for policy compliance, and reports confirmed incidents.
Core Responsibilities:
- Platform Administration: Build, maintain, and optimize the CrowdStrike Falcon environment. Manage technical changes, respond to escalated Tier II/III issues, assist with compatibility evaluations, and perform root cause analysis.
- Security Operations & Triage: Proactively monitor and evaluate Falcon detections for malicious activity. Perform initial triage, tune prevention policies, develop custom Indicators of Compromise (IOCs), and report confirmed incidents
- Compliance & Readiness: Validate and enforce security configurations against STIG and TASKORD directives to ensure policy compliance. Audit and validate the endpoint security posture for CCRI/CORA readiness and report alerting events to Market Place Cyber Support (MPS) and ECMR for compliance monitoring.
- Policy & Deployment: Implement the strategy for sensor deployment, security policy tuning, and the rollout of new Falcon capabilities (e.g., Application Control, Device Control) across the enterprise.

Highly Desired Technical Skills
- CrowdStrike Expertise: Deep knowledge of the CrowdStrike Falcon platform, including Prevent/Insight (NGAV/EDR), Discover (Asset Inventory), Device Control (DLP), and Falcon Control (Application Control).
- Systems Administration: Strong background in both Windows and Linux OS administration in a large enterprise (2,000+ servers).
- SIEM Integration: Experience developing security-focused content and dashboards in Splunk using endpoint security data.
